Add 3/9 and 15/27
3/9 + 15/27 is 8/9.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 9 and 27 is 27
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 27 - For the 1st fraction, since 9 × 3 = 27,
3/9 = 3 × 3/9 × 3 = 9/27 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 27 × 1 = 27,
15/27 = 15 × 1/27 × 1 = 15/27 - Add the two like fractions:
9/27 + 15/27 = 9 + 15/27 = 24/27 - 24/27 simplified gives 8/9
- So, 3/9 + 15/27 = 8/9
